Establish a Comprehensive Cleaning List
Developing a complete cleansing list can make your Airbnb turnover procedure smoother and more efficient. Begin by providing all locations in your space, including bedrooms, washrooms, kitchen area, and living areas. Damage down each location right into details jobs. In the kitchen, include cleaning down counter tops, cleansing devices, and cleaning recipes.
Do not fail to remember the information-- look for dirt on surface areas, clean mirrors, and vacuum carpets. Include washing jobs like altering bedding and towels, as fresh bed linens can leave an enduring perception.
By following this checklist, you'll streamline your cleansing process, reduce stress and anxiety, and ensure your visitors show up to a spick-and-span atmosphere. Plus, a tidy home enhances visitor complete satisfaction and urges positive reviews, which is vital for your Airbnb success.
Focus On High-Traffic Areas
Considering that visitors are likely to invest more time in specific areas of your Airbnb, prioritizing high-traffic areas during your cleansing routine is important. Focus on spaces like the living space, kitchen, and shower room, where visitors gather and utilize regularly. Start by decluttering these areas, as a neat room promptly feels even more welcoming.
Following, give special interest to surface areas that build up dirt and grime, such as counter tops, tables, and chairs. Do not forget to clean floors completely; a fast vacuum cleaner or move can make a substantial difference.
In the shower room, validate that sinks, toilets, and shower areas are pristine, as these are vital for visitor convenience (Commercial Cleaning). Make use of a lint roller for upholstery and pillows to keep them fresh. By focusing on these high-traffic areas, you'll create a welcoming ambience that leaves a long lasting perception on your guests, enhancing their general remain
Utilize the Right Cleaning Products
After tackling the high-traffic areas, it's time to reflect on the cleaning items you make use of. Selecting the ideal cleaning products can make all the distinction in attaining a spick-and-span room that wows your guests. Start by selecting all-round cleansers that work on numerous surface areas, saving you time and effort. Look for eco-friendly alternatives to attract ecologically mindful visitors; they'll value your commitment to sustainability.
Do not forget concerning anti-bacterials-- especially in washrooms and kitchen areas. Ensure they're EPA-approved for optimum efficiency versus germs. Microfiber fabrics are vital for dusting and cleaning down surfaces given that they capture dust without scraping.
For floors, discover a cleaner ideal for your flooring kind, whether it's wood, floor tile, or laminate. Lastly, consider adding a positive fragrance with air fresheners or crucial oils, as a fresh-smelling area boosts the overall experience. Your choice of products can truly boost your Airbnb's cleanliness and atmosphere.

Keep a Consistent Cleansing Schedule
Preserving a regular cleaning schedule is essential for maintaining your Airbnb in leading shape and making sure guest satisfaction. By establishing a regular cleaning regimen, you develop a reputable setting for your guests, which helps develop depend on and motivates positive testimonials. Begin by establishing a cleansing regularity that matches your property and visitor turnover.
After each visitor's remain, assign time for comprehensive cleansing, consisting of cleaning, vacuuming, and sanitizing high-touch areas. Do not neglect to inspect linens and towels, ensuring they're tidy and fresh for the next arrival.
Along with post-checkout cleaning, consider scheduling weekly upkeep jobs, such as deep cleansing rugs or windows. This will avoid dust buildup and keep your home looking immaculate.
Ultimately, stay with your schedule as carefully as possible. Uniformity not just enhances your visitors' experience yet additionally shows your dedication to high quality friendliness.

Regularly Asked Questions
Just how Typically Should I Deep Tidy My Airbnb Residential Or Commercial Property?
You need to deep clean your Airbnb property at least as soon as a month. If you have high turnover or pet dogs, consider doing it much more regularly. Regular deep cleaning maintains your room fresh and welcoming for visitors.
What Are Eco-Friendly Cleaning Product Options?
When you're selecting environment-friendly cleansing items, consider options like vinegar, baking soft drink, and castile soap. They work, safe for your visitors, and far better for the atmosphere. You'll click site be impressed at their cleaning power!
Exactly How Can I Take Care Of Cleaning After a Family Pet Remain?
After a pet dog keep, vacuum thoroughly to remove hair, use enzyme cleaners for spots, and wash all linens. Do not neglect to air out the area and look for any type of sticking around smells to assure quality.
Should I Work With Specialist Cleaners or Do It Myself?
You ought to consider your time and budget. If you're active or want a comprehensive tidy, hiring specialists may be best. Doing it on your own can conserve cash. if you enjoy cleansing and have the time.
How Can I Lessen Cleaning Time Between Visitors?
To decrease cleansing time between guests, produce a list, declutter frequently, utilize multi-purpose cleaners, and keep essential supplies stocked. Prioritize high-traffic areas and consider a cleansing schedule to simplify your process efficiently.
